++#ifndef _MMNET1000_H
++#define _MMNET1000_H
++
++/* ******************************************************************* */
++/* PMC Settings                                                        */
++/*                                                                     */
++/* The main oscillator is enabled as soon as possible in the c_startup */
++/* and MCK is switched on the main oscillator.                         */
++/* PLL initialization is done later in the hw_init() function          */
++/* ******************************************************************* */
++#define MASTER_CLOCK          (198656000/2)
++#define PLL_LOCK_TIMEOUT      1000000
++
++#define PLLA_SETTINGS 0x2060BF09
++#define PLLB_SETTINGS 0x10483F0E
++
++/* Switch MCK on PLLA output PCK = PLLA = 2 * MCK */
++#define MCKR_SETTINGS         (AT91C_PMC_PRES_CLK | AT91C_PMC_MDIV_2)
++#define MCKR_CSS_SETTINGS     (AT91C_PMC_CSS_PLLA_CLK | MCKR_SETTINGS)
++
++/* ******************************************************************* */
++/* NandFlash Settings                                                  */
++/*                                                                     */
++/* ******************************************************************* */
++#define AT91C_SMARTMEDIA_BASE 0x40000000
++
++#define AT91_SMART_MEDIA_ALE    (1 << 21)     /* our ALE is AD21 */
++#define AT91_SMART_MEDIA_CLE    (1 << 22)     /* our CLE is AD22 */
++
++#define NAND_DISABLE_CE() do { *(volatile unsigned int *)AT91C_PIOC_SODR = 
AT91C_PIO_PC14;} while(0)
++#define NAND_ENABLE_CE() do { *(volatile unsigned int *)AT91C_PIOC_CODR = 
AT91C_PIO_PC14;} while(0)
++
++#define NAND_WAIT_READY() while (!(*(volatile unsigned int *)AT91C_PIOC_PDSR 
& AT91C_PIO_PC13))
++
++
++/* ******************************************************************** */
++/* SMC Chip Select 3 Timings for NandFlash for MASTER_CLOCK = 100000000.*/
++/* Please refer to SMC section in AT91SAM datasheet to learn how      */
++/* to generate these values.                                          */
++/* ******************************************************************** */
++#define AT91C_SM_NWE_SETUP    (1 << 0)
++#define AT91C_SM_NCS_WR_SETUP (0 << 8)
++#define AT91C_SM_NRD_SETUP    (1 << 16)
++#define AT91C_SM_NCS_RD_SETUP (0 << 24)
++  
++#define AT91C_SM_NWE_PULSE    (3 << 0)
++#define AT91C_SM_NCS_WR_PULSE (3 << 8)
++#define AT91C_SM_NRD_PULSE    (3 << 16)
++#define AT91C_SM_NCS_RD_PULSE (3 << 24)
++  
++#define AT91C_SM_NWE_CYCLE    (5 << 0)
++#define AT91C_SM_NRD_CYCLE    (5 << 16)
++#define AT91C_SM_TDF          (2 << 16)
++
++/* ******************************************************************* */
++/* BootStrap Settings                                                  */
++/*                                                                     */
++/* ******************************************************************* */
++#define IMG_ADDRESS           0x40000         /* Image Address in NandFlash */
++#define       IMG_SIZE                0x40000         /* Image Size in 
NandFlash    */
++
++#define MACH_TYPE             0x919           /* MMnet1000 */
++#define JUMP_ADDR             0x23F00000      /* Final Jump Address         */
++
++/* ******************************************************************* */
++/* Application Settings                                                */
++/* ******************************************************************* */
++#undef CFG_DEBUG
++#undef CFG_DATAFLASH
++
++#define CFG_NANDFLASH
++#undef        NANDFLASH_SMALL_BLOCKS  /* NANDFLASH_LARGE_BLOCKS used instead 
*/
++
++#define CFG_HW_INIT
++#define CFG_SDRAM
++
++#endif        /* _MMNET1000_H */
